Output 109cc4ab902f1af392996bfa6064316484e2a75e98b3810914243bcc4d5158ee:1

value
1963456
script pubkey
OP_0 OP_PUSHBYTES_20 d3c327e7642f2597b68a241deeba09cb82b49eb1
address
bc1q60pj0emy9uje0d52ysw7awsfewptf843pcd865
transaction
109cc4ab902f1af392996bfa6064316484e2a75e98b3810914243bcc4d5158ee